Description

Established in 1947 and head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, Seika Corporation is a global enterprise specializing in the import, sale, and export of a diverse range of industrial plants, machinery, and advanced equipment. Their extensive portfolio serves clients across Asia, Europe, the United States, and other international markets. The company provides cutting-edge power generation solutions, encompassing flywheel uninterruptible power supplies, gas turbine combined cycle systems, cogeneration units, and renewable energy technologies like wind, thermal, hydraulic, biomass, and solar power equipment. Seika also offers critical environmental protection systems, including explosion control, VOC recovery, solder paste recycling, various air treatment devices, and analytical monitoring instruments. Beyond these, their offerings extend to specialized chemical processing equipment and materials (such as synthetic fiber manufacturing tools, films, and polymer removal systems), comprehensive food processing and sterilization technologies, a broad array of general industrial machinery (from robotics like UT drones and 3D printers to sorting and packaging equipment, along with industrial software), and precision electronic and measurement devices. Furthermore, the company supplies essential raw materials and components, including diverse printed circuit boards, alongside specialized equipment for wastewater treatment, construction, and textile industries, demonstrating their wide-ranging support for manufacturing and infrastructure worldwide.
